Pt. Birju Maharaj, Shovana Narayan, Piyush Mishra - if these names make you jump with joy then, there's something really exciting coming up. Starting on Feb 21 is this three-day cultural festival called, Jashn-E-Hind that aims to celebrate the ethos of India.

At this festival, you can expect panel discussions, ghazals, sufi music, classic dance and music, qawwalis, book launches, open-mics, folk performances, and a lot more that you could look forward to.
